Harrow Technical will cease trading 29/3- Robin Gowing Retiring

Hi All

I just wanted to put a message out that Harrow Technical will cease trading on the 29th March as Robin Gowing is retiring. I've only used Robin recently but I'm sure there are some out there who've had longer relationships with Harrow.

It's a shame to to lose a Pentax specialist, particularly now I appear to have stock piled a number of Pentax film cameras after only venturing into film 8 months ago!.
